OpenAI Codex CLI

2026-04-06

Users are experiencing critical stability issues with long-lived CLI sessions, including data loss on exit, memory leaks causing system freezes, orphaned child processes, and crashes when handling long chat histories. These issues undermine trust in the tool for important work, as users risk losing progress and context when sessions become unstable.

Roo Code

2026-04-06

Users want granular control over AI assistant behavior per project/mode, including per-mode auto-approve settings, MCP server access controls, and custom model/provider handling. This includes fixing issues with custom model names, temperature defaults, and AWS Bedrock caching, while adding new features like external skill repository imports and MCP tool allowlisting.

Cline

2026-04-06

Users are reporting multiple bugs affecting the command-line and terminal user interface experience, including platform-specific issues (particularly on Windows), UI state synchronization problems when switching between modes, tool execution hangs and parsing failures, and display/rendering issues in terminal environments. These issues collectively degrade the reliability and usability of the CLI/TUI for daily development workflows.

aider

2026-04-06

Users are requesting better error handling across various failure scenarios including missing configurations, network failures, invalid data, and dependency issues. Additionally, there are requests to improve CLI argument validation, add non-interactive single-pass execution modes for automation, and fix cross-platform compatibility issues with Windows glob patterns.
